Arlington, VA

This tech forum featured discussions with federal cybersecurity leaders about zero day vulnerabilities, cloud security, partnership strategies, supply chain risk management, continuous diagnostics and mitigation programs, and more. Speakers included experts from the FBI, VA, Air Force, SBA, DHS,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Security Agency, U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services, National Cancer Institute, U.S. Patent and Trademark Office, National Cancer Institute, BlackBerry Cylance and NewWave.
